Regardless of if he polls votes in the midfielder award, Jason Blake is the type of clubman that builds a club and a culture.

He has played under Watson, Blight, Thomas,Lyon, and now Watters, and has rarely been dropped.

Has played, back, forward, in the mids, in the ruck, has tagged players such as Goodes with success, has rucked against Sandilands and co.

He has done everything asked of him and more, showing his team orientation by being delisted and redrafted so the team could put a higher paid player on the vets list.

A true Saints man who has always tried his best with his limited abilities, and has never shirked a contest.

To me it is moot if he ever wins a vote in the mids award, the umpires wouldn't know s.hit from clay, jason Blake has the respect of football supporters who know anythign about spirit and sacrifice.

Kudo's = gotta love the Blake.
